Skip to content

Commit 6a0a2c5

Browse files
Update husky to the latest version 🚀 (#507)
* chore(package): update husky to version 4.2.2 * chore(package): update lockfile yarn.lock
1 parent 1b1b9f8 commit 6a0a2c5

File tree

2 files changed

+33
-84
lines changed

2 files changed

+33
-84
lines changed

package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-119,7 +119,7 @@
119119
"@types/sade": "^1.6.0",
120120
"@types/semver": "^7.1.0",
121121
"doctoc": "^1.4.0",
122-
"husky": "^3.0.9",
122+
"husky": "^4.2.2",
123123
"pretty-quick": "^2.0.0",
124124
"ps-tree": "^1.2.0",
125125
"react": "^16.8.6",

yarn.lock

Lines changed: 32 additions & 83 deletions
Original file line numberDiff line numberDiff line change
@@ -1125,11 +1125,6 @@
11251125
resolved "https://registry.yarnpkg.com/@types/node/-/node-13.1.0.tgz#225cbaac5fdb2b9ac651b02c070d8aa3c37cc812"
11261126
integrity sha512-zwrxviZS08kRX40nqBrmERElF2vpw4IUTd5khkhBTfFH8AOaeoLVx48EC4+ZzS2/Iga7NevncqnsUSYjM4OWYA==
11271127

1128-
"@types/normalize-package-data@^2.4.0":
1129-
version "2.4.0"
1130-
resolved "https://registry.yarnpkg.com/@types/normalize-package-data/-/normalize-package-data-2.4.0.tgz#e486d0d97396d79beedd0a6e33f4534ff6b4973e"
1131-
integrity sha512-f5j5b/Gf71L+dbqxIpQ4Z2WlmI/mPJ0fOkGGmFgtb6sAu97EPczzbS3/tJKxmcYDj55OX6ssqwDAWOHIYDRDGA==
1132-
11331128
"@types/ora@^3.2.0":
11341129
version "3.2.0"
11351130
resolved "https://registry.yarnpkg.com/@types/ora/-/ora-3.2.0.tgz#b2f65d1283a8f36d8b0f9ee767e0732a2f429362"
@@ -1813,25 +1808,6 @@ cache-base@^1.0.1:
18131808
union-value "^1.0.0"
18141809
unset-value "^1.0.0"
18151810

1816-
caller-callsite@^2.0.0:
1817-
version "2.0.0"
1818-
resolved "https://registry.yarnpkg.com/caller-callsite/-/caller-callsite-2.0.0.tgz#847e0fce0a223750a9a027c54b33731ad3154134"
1819-
integrity sha1-hH4PzgoiN1CpoCfFSzNzGtMVQTQ=
1820-
dependencies:
1821-
callsites "^2.0.0"
1822-
1823-
caller-path@^2.0.0:
1824-
version "2.0.0"
1825-
resolved "https://registry.yarnpkg.com/caller-path/-/caller-path-2.0.0.tgz#468f83044e369ab2010fac5f06ceee15bb2cb1f4"
1826-
integrity sha1-Ro+DBE42mrIBD6xfBs7uFbsssfQ=
1827-
dependencies:
1828-
caller-callsite "^2.0.0"
1829-
1830-
callsites@^2.0.0:
1831-
version "2.0.0"
1832-
resolved "https://registry.yarnpkg.com/callsites/-/callsites-2.0.0.tgz#06eb84f00eea413da86affefacbffb36093b3c50"
1833-
integrity sha1-BuuE8A7qQT2oav/vrL/7Ngk7PFA=
1834-
18351811
callsites@^3.0.0:
18361812
version "3.1.0"
18371813
resolved "https://registry.yarnpkg.com/callsites/-/callsites-3.1.0.tgz#b3630abd8943432f54b3f0519238e33cd7df2f73"
@@ -2076,6 +2052,11 @@ commondir@^1.0.1:
20762052
resolved "https://registry.yarnpkg.com/commondir/-/commondir-1.0.1.tgz#ddd800da0c66127393cca5950ea968a3aaf1253b"
20772053
integrity sha1-3dgA2gxmEnOTzKWVDqloo6rxJTs=
20782054

2055+
compare-versions@^3.5.1:
2056+
version "3.5.1"
2057+
resolved "https://registry.yarnpkg.com/compare-versions/-/compare-versions-3.5.1.tgz#26e1f5cf0d48a77eced5046b9f67b6b61075a393"
2058+
integrity sha512-9fGPIB7C6AyM18CJJBHt5EnCZDG3oiTJYy0NjfIAGjKpzv0tkxWko7TNQHF5ymqm7IH03tqmeuBxtvD+Izh6mg==
2059+
20792060
component-emitter@^1.2.1:
20802061
version "1.3.0"
20812062
resolved "https://registry.yarnpkg.com/component-emitter/-/component-emitter-1.3.0.tgz#16e4070fba8ae29b679f2215853ee181ab2eabc0"
@@ -2136,16 +2117,6 @@ core-util-is@1.0.2, core-util-is@~1.0.0:
21362117
resolved "https://registry.yarnpkg.com/core-util-is/-/core-util-is-1.0.2.tgz#b5fd54220aa2bc5ab57aab7140c940754503c1a7"
21372118
integrity sha1-tf1UIgqivFq1eqtxQMlAdUUDwac=
21382119

2139-
cosmiconfig@^5.2.1:
2140-
version "5.2.1"
2141-
resolved "https://registry.yarnpkg.com/cosmiconfig/-/cosmiconfig-5.2.1.tgz#040f726809c591e77a17c0a3626ca45b4f168b1a"
2142-
integrity sha512-H65gsXo1SKjf8zmrJ67eJk8aIRKV5ff2D4uKZIBZShbhGSpEmsQOPW/SKMKYhSTrqR7ufy6RP69rPogdaPh/kA==
2143-
dependencies:
2144-
import-fresh "^2.0.0"
2145-
is-directory "^0.3.1"
2146-
js-yaml "^3.13.1"
2147-
parse-json "^4.0.0"
2148-
21492120
cosmiconfig@^6.0.0:
21502121
version "6.0.0"
21512122
resolved "https://registry.yarnpkg.com/cosmiconfig/-/cosmiconfig-6.0.0.tgz#da4fee853c52f6b1e6935f41c1a2fc50bd4a9982"
@@ -2956,6 +2927,13 @@ find-up@^4.0.0, find-up@^4.1.0:
29562927
locate-path "^5.0.0"
29572928
path-exists "^4.0.0"
29582929

2930+
find-versions@^3.2.0:
2931+
version "3.2.0"
2932+
resolved "https://registry.yarnpkg.com/find-versions/-/find-versions-3.2.0.tgz#10297f98030a786829681690545ef659ed1d254e"
2933+
integrity sha512-P8WRou2S+oe222TOCHitLy8zj+SIsVJh52VP4lvXkaFVnOFFdoWv1H1Jjvel1aI6NCFOAaeAVm8qrI0odiLcww==
2934+
dependencies:
2935+
semver-regex "^2.0.0"
2936+
29592937
flat-cache@^2.0.1:
29602938
version "2.0.1"
29612939
resolved "https://registry.yarnpkg.com/flat-cache/-/flat-cache-2.0.1.tgz#5d296d6f04bda44a4630a301413bdbc2ec085ec0"
@@ -3069,11 +3047,6 @@ get-stdin@^6.0.0:
30693047
resolved "https://registry.yarnpkg.com/get-stdin/-/get-stdin-6.0.0.tgz#9e09bf712b360ab9225e812048f71fde9c89657b"
30703048
integrity sha512-jp4tHawyV7+fkkSKyvjuLZswblUtz+SQKzSWnBbii16BuZksJlU1wuBYXY75r+duh/llF1ur6oNwi+2ZzjKZ7g==
30713049

3072-
get-stdin@^7.0.0:
3073-
version "7.0.0"
3074-
resolved "https://registry.yarnpkg.com/get-stdin/-/get-stdin-7.0.0.tgz#8d5de98f15171a125c5e516643c7a6d0ea8a96f6"
3075-
integrity sha512-zRKcywvrXlXsA0v0i9Io4KDRaAw7+a1ZpjRwl9Wox8PFlVCCHra7E9c4kqXCoCM9nR5tBkaTTZRBoCm60bFqTQ==
3076-
30773050
get-stream@^4.0.0:
30783051
version "4.1.0"
30793052
resolved "https://registry.yarnpkg.com/get-stream/-/get-stream-4.1.0.tgz#c1b255575f3dc21d59bfc79cd3d2b46b1c3a54b5"
@@ -3296,22 +3269,21 @@ humanize-duration@^3.15.3:
32963269
resolved "https://registry.yarnpkg.com/humanize-duration/-/humanize-duration-3.21.0.tgz#ae5dc7e67640770cbf6a8d03a5d1138d47c7ce38"
32973270
integrity sha512-7BLsrQZ2nMGeakmGDUl1pDne6/7iAdvwf1RtDLCOPHNFIHjkOVW7lcu7xHkIM9HhZAlSSO5crhC1dHvtl4dIQw==
32983271

3299-
husky@^3.0.9:
3300-
version "3.1.0"
3301-
resolved "https://registry.yarnpkg.com/husky/-/husky-3.1.0.tgz#5faad520ab860582ed94f0c1a77f0f04c90b57c0"
3302-
integrity sha512-FJkPoHHB+6s4a+jwPqBudBDvYZsoQW5/HBuMSehC8qDiCe50kpcxeqFoDSlow+9I6wg47YxBoT3WxaURlrDIIQ==
3272+
husky@^4.2.2:
3273+
version "4.2.2"
3274+
resolved "https://registry.yarnpkg.com/husky/-/husky-4.2.2.tgz#aa858a99ad685f13ab5f99fa71b60e0fe0cd9048"
3275+
integrity sha512-RAjZNO74zJyFJuRFESy+3LXTJvYbjGL+jhoSNJNF1DTKq2USrL5fEH70e1cJXEgvLaPyZt1NoGi0oNQQkPs4jA==
33033276
dependencies:
3304-
chalk "^2.4.2"
3277+
chalk "^3.0.0"
33053278
ci-info "^2.0.0"
3306-
cosmiconfig "^5.2.1"
3307-
execa "^1.0.0"
3308-
get-stdin "^7.0.0"
3279+
compare-versions "^3.5.1"
3280+
cosmiconfig "^6.0.0"
3281+
find-versions "^3.2.0"
33093282
opencollective-postinstall "^2.0.2"
33103283
pkg-dir "^4.2.0"
33113284
please-upgrade-node "^3.2.0"
3312-
read-pkg "^5.2.0"
3313-
run-node "^1.0.0"
33143285
slash "^3.0.0"
3286+
which-pm-runs "^1.0.0"
33153287

33163288
iconv-lite@0.4.24, iconv-lite@^0.4.24, iconv-lite@^0.4.4:
33173289
version "0.4.24"
@@ -3337,14 +3309,6 @@ ignore@^5.1.4:
33373309
resolved "https://registry.yarnpkg.com/ignore/-/ignore-5.1.4.tgz#84b7b3dbe64552b6ef0eca99f6743dbec6d97adf"
33383310
integrity sha512-MzbUSahkTW1u7JpKKjY7LCARd1fU5W2rLdxlM4kdkayuCwZImjkpluF9CM1aLewYJguPDqewLam18Y6AU69A8A==
33393311

3340-
import-fresh@^2.0.0:
3341-
version "2.0.0"
3342-
resolved "https://registry.yarnpkg.com/import-fresh/-/import-fresh-2.0.0.tgz#d81355c15612d386c61f9ddd3922d4304822a546"
3343-
integrity sha1-2BNVwVYS04bGH53dOSLUMEgipUY=
3344-
dependencies:
3345-
caller-path "^2.0.0"
3346-
resolve-from "^3.0.0"
3347-
33483312
import-fresh@^3.0.0, import-fresh@^3.1.0:
33493313
version "3.2.1"
33503314
resolved "https://registry.yarnpkg.com/import-fresh/-/import-fresh-3.2.1.tgz#633ff618506e793af5ac91bf48b72677e15cbe66"
@@ -3513,11 +3477,6 @@ is-descriptor@^1.0.0, is-descriptor@^1.0.2:
35133477
is-data-descriptor "^1.0.0"
35143478
kind-of "^6.0.2"
35153479

3516-
is-directory@^0.3.1:
3517-
version "0.3.1"
3518-
resolved "https://registry.yarnpkg.com/is-directory/-/is-directory-0.3.1.tgz#61339b6f2475fc772fd9c9d83f5c8575dc154ae1"
3519-
integrity sha1-YTObbyR1/Hcv2cnYP1yFddwVSuE=
3520-
35213480
is-extendable@^0.1.0, is-extendable@^0.1.1:
35223481
version "0.1.1"
35233482
resolved "https://registry.yarnpkg.com/is-extendable/-/is-extendable-0.1.1.tgz#62b110e289a471418e3ec36a617d472e301dfc89"
@@ -4682,7 +4641,7 @@ nopt@^4.0.1:
46824641
abbrev "1"
46834642
osenv "^0.1.4"
46844643

4685-
normalize-package-data@^2.3.2, normalize-package-data@^2.5.0:
4644+
normalize-package-data@^2.3.2:
46864645
version "2.5.0"
46874646
resolved "https://registry.yarnpkg.com/normalize-package-data/-/normalize-package-data-2.5.0.tgz#e66db1838b200c1dfc233225d12cb36520e234a8"
46884647
integrity sha512-/5CMN3T0R4XTj4DcGaexo+roZSdSFW/0AOOTROrjxzCG1wrWXEsGbRKevjlIL+ZDE4sZlJr5ED4YW0yqmkK+eA==
@@ -5368,16 +5327,6 @@ read-pkg@^3.0.0:
53685327
normalize-package-data "^2.3.2"
53695328
path-type "^3.0.0"
53705329

5371-
read-pkg@^5.2.0:
5372-
version "5.2.0"
5373-
resolved "https://registry.yarnpkg.com/read-pkg/-/read-pkg-5.2.0.tgz#7bf295438ca5a33e56cd30e053b34ee7250c93cc"
5374-
integrity sha512-Ug69mNOpfvKDAc2Q8DRpMjjzdtrnv9HcSMX+4VsZxD1aZ6ZzrIE7rlzXBtWTyhULSMKg076AW6WR5iZpD0JiOg==
5375-
dependencies:
5376-
"@types/normalize-package-data" "^2.4.0"
5377-
normalize-package-data "^2.5.0"
5378-
parse-json "^5.0.0"
5379-
type-fest "^0.6.0"
5380-
53815330
readable-stream@^2.0.2, readable-stream@^2.0.6:
53825331
version "2.3.6"
53835332
resolved "https://registry.yarnpkg.com/readable-stream/-/readable-stream-2.3.6.tgz#b11c27d88b8ff1fbe070643cf94b0c79ae1b0aaf"
@@ -5750,11 +5699,6 @@ run-async@^2.2.0:
57505699
dependencies:
57515700
is-promise "^2.1.0"
57525701

5753-
run-node@^1.0.0:
5754-
version "1.0.0"
5755-
resolved "https://registry.yarnpkg.com/run-node/-/run-node-1.0.0.tgz#46b50b946a2aa2d4947ae1d886e9856fd9cabe5e"
5756-
integrity sha512-kc120TBlQ3mih1LSzdAJXo4xn/GWS2ec0l3S+syHDXP9uRr0JAT8Qd3mdMuyjqCzeZktgP3try92cEgf9Nks8A==
5757-
57585702
rxjs@^6.4.0:
57595703
version "6.5.3"
57605704
resolved "https://registry.yarnpkg.com/rxjs/-/rxjs-6.5.3.tgz#510e26317f4db91a7eb1de77d9dd9ba0a4899a3a"
@@ -5816,6 +5760,11 @@ semver-compare@^1.0.0:
58165760
resolved "https://registry.yarnpkg.com/semver-compare/-/semver-compare-1.0.0.tgz#0dee216a1c941ab37e9efb1788f6afc5ff5537fc"
58175761
integrity sha1-De4hahyUGrN+nvsXiPavxf9VN/w=
58185762

5763+
semver-regex@^2.0.0:
5764+
version "2.0.0"
5765+
resolved "https://registry.yarnpkg.com/semver-regex/-/semver-regex-2.0.0.tgz#a93c2c5844539a770233379107b38c7b4ac9d338"
5766+
integrity sha512-mUdIBBvdn0PLOeP3TEkMH7HHeUP3GjsXCwKarjv/kGmUFOYg1VqEemKhoQpWMu6X2I8kHeuVdGibLGkVK+/5Qw==
5767+
58195768
"semver@2 || 3 || 4 || 5", semver@^5.3.0, semver@^5.4.1, semver@^5.5, semver@^5.5.0, semver@^5.5.1, semver@^5.6.0:
58205769
version "5.7.1"
58215770
resolved "https://registry.yarnpkg.com/semver/-/semver-5.7.1.tgz#a954f931aeba508d307bbf069eff0c01c96116f7"
@@ -6444,11 +6393,6 @@ type-check@~0.3.2:
64446393
dependencies:
64456394
prelude-ls "~1.1.2"
64466395

6447-
type-fest@^0.6.0:
6448-
version "0.6.0"
6449-
resolved "https://registry.yarnpkg.com/type-fest/-/type-fest-0.6.0.tgz#8d2a2370d3df886eb5c90ada1c5bf6188acf838b"
6450-
integrity sha512-q+MB8nYR1KDLrgr4G5yemftpMC7/QLqVndBmEEdqzmNj5dcFOO4Oo8qlwZE3ULT3+Zim1F8Kq4cBnikNhlCMlg==
6451-
64526396
type-fest@^0.8.1:
64536397
version "0.8.1"
64546398
resolved "https://registry.yarnpkg.com/type-fest/-/type-fest-0.8.1.tgz#09e249ebde851d3b1e48d27c105444667f17b83d"
@@ -6731,6 +6675,11 @@ which-module@^2.0.0:
67316675
resolved "https://registry.yarnpkg.com/which-module/-/which-module-2.0.0.tgz#d9ef07dce77b9902b8a3a8fa4b31c3e3f7e6e87a"
67326676
integrity sha1-2e8H3Od7mQK4o6j6SzHD4/fm6Ho=
67336677

6678+
which-pm-runs@^1.0.0:
6679+
version "1.0.0"
6680+
resolved "https://registry.yarnpkg.com/which-pm-runs/-/which-pm-runs-1.0.0.tgz#670b3afbc552e0b55df6b7780ca74615f23ad1cb"
6681+
integrity sha1-Zws6+8VS4LVd9rd4DKdGFfI60cs=
6682+
67346683
which@^1.2.9, which@^1.3.0:
67356684
version "1.3.1"
67366685
resolved "https://registry.yarnpkg.com/which/-/which-1.3.1.tgz#a45043d54f5805316da8d62f9f50918d3da70b0a"

0 commit comments

Comments
 (0)